During project execution, a project manager discovers that the budget at completion has shifted significantly and is higher than expected. What should the project manager do?

A. Perform a root cause analysis of the project performance.

B. Adjust the original budget estimates with the current cost variance.

C. Review the activity duration to reforecast the project completion date.

D. Negotiate the project changes and adjust stakeholder expectations.










Correct Answer: A
